Join Here:⁠⁠⁠⁠ ⁠⁠https://ow.ly.../msoH50WCu0K⁠⁠⁠⁠ In this episode of The Notorious Mass Effect, host Analytic Dreamz examines BTS’s decision to skip Grammy submissions for 2027 amid the new Asian Pop category, questioning if the awards are losing major stars. The 2026 Grammys drew 14.4 million viewers, down 6% from 15.4 million in 2025. Analytic Dreamz also covers music updates on Jay-Z, Beyoncé, Future, FIFA theme songs, and Gracie Abrams; industry news including Drake’s Neuromancer involvement, the Michael biopic hitting #1 with $977 million worldwide as the highest-grossing biopic ever, and Charlamagne’s Illuminati book; gaming titles like Palworld (over 30 million players), Rhythm Heaven Groove, Kingshot, The Mound Omen, and Splatoon Raiders; plus drama between Usher and Chris Brown. As when it comes to the biggest difference between Powell World 1.0 that just came out July 10, 2026 and the early access version that came out January 19, 2024, the main difference is 72 new pals.
Starting point is 00:14:27 So 47 new plus 25 variants. So now the total roster is a whopping 287. And then that's not it. As there are new regions as far as the sun reach floating sky islands and World Tree, which the major endgame slash story hub hopefully it's not spoiler and it is double the exploreable area right and then of course another main change from the early access to power world 1.0 is the level cap so now it's been raised from 65 to 80 with expanded ancient tech tree and new unlocks and of course to keep going because there's more ladies and gentlemen they didn't just take a long time to put out 1.0 for no
Starting point is 00:15:07 reason. Awakening and mutation, meaning there's new systems for strengthening pals as far as radiant gems with hidden potential mutated eggs for higher stats slash passives. And of course, you have reworked progression and combat base building overhaul. And what I mean by that is offshore slash water bases expanded options and better management. And of course, the trend transversial due to the lawsuit, a new wing pack that is a gear slot glider slash flight which frees the power slots and it's it's improved gliding slash flying now of course if you still want to glide on a pow world no not power on a pal i believe it is possible via the mods this game is the most popular on steam for a reason i believe people reverted what pocket pair had to do legally and made it to where you

But when you look at it, as far as the game, Gameplay loop is a classic rhythm gameplay.
Starting point is 00:37:45 Basically, timing button presses primarily with A plus occasionally B and D pad inputs, heavy emphasis on listening to music and audio cues rather than visual prompts. That's why you may get confused on the multiple games popping up throughout my coverage of this game because analytic dreams video on Spotify to see the video along with the audio because I'm currently showing gameplay. But of course, all the different mini games that you're seeing on the screen, they follow the classic rhythm gameplay feature as far as time and button presses primarily due to music and audio cues rather than the visual prompts. So it's more humorous, you know, fast-paced rhythm challenges and very interesting scenarios, as you can see right now.
Starting point is 00:38:29 80 plus brand new rhythm mini games and this rhythm having groove, which is fantastic, right? but then of course you have stages that contain roughly four many games followed by a remix and combining mechanics from previous games and in a high rankings amazing slash superb medals unlocked bonus content so you probably be thinking to you so as a nine to five worker how long would this game take me well i'm glad you ask you guys as the main story will take you around five and a half to six hours the main story plus extras will take you around 11 to 12 hours and of course completion is it will take you from 20 to 24 hours now when it comes to the price point i do not believe i pulled up the actual price so i want to see how much this game
